November 20, 2025 by Herb | Leave a Comment Raised beds play a crucial role in preventing waterlogged soil by improving drainage and providing a controlled environment for plants. By elevating the planting area, raised beds allow excess water to drain away more efficiently, reducing the risk of root rot and other moisture-related issues. November 20, 2025 by Herb | Leave a Comment Waterlogged soil can significantly impact soil pH levels by creating anaerobic conditions that alter the chemical processes in the soil. These conditions can lead to changes in pH, often resulting in more acidic or sometimes more alkaline environments, depending on the soil type and organic matter present.
